I hope your 2021 is off to a good start. While the 2020 Election Cycle might be over, the New York City Mayoral race is just getting started. As New York City continues to work through COVID’s devastation, all eyes are on this important office. In the next five months voters in New York City will head to the ballot to elect their top official. With everything from economic recovery and health care, to education and criminal justice reform at stake for our country’s most populous city, the candidates are seeking to strike the right balance of resolute action and compassion when charting their course forward.
Knowing there is great local and national interest in this critical election, I am proud to share that Core Decision Analytics (CODA), the dedicated opinion insights and data analytics firm within Core Strategic Group, has launched “Pulse of the Primary: 2021 NYC Mayor’s Race.”
This multi-part polling series, conducted in partnership with Fontas Advisors, takes an independent look at voter attitudes on key issues and candidates. Given the overwhelming registration advantage Democrats hold in New York City, whomever wins the June primary will almost certainly become the next mayor.
